Radio Caprice - Modern Classical is an intriguing and captivating online radio station that offers a unique musical experience for lovers of contemporary classical music. With a vast collection of modern classical compositions, this radio station aims to bridge the gap between traditional classical music and the cutting-edge compositions of the modern era.
The station features an impressive array of diverse and engaging tracks, showcasing the work of both renowned contemporary classical composers and emerging talents from around the world. Listeners can expect to discover a wide range of musical styles, from minimalist compositions to experimental and avant-garde pieces.
